Listings in Entertainment, 2 Star Hotels, Asian and Chinese Food, Spas and Travels in Sherman

Showing 1 of 1 results
Arts Center
4800 Texoma Pkwy, Sherman, Texas 75090, United States
Is this your listing?

Download our App